Mastering Clear Aligner Orthodontics

A 2-Day Hands-On CE Course for General Dentists 

Build a structured, practical foundation in clear aligner orthodontics, from case assessment and diagnosis to treatment planning, prescription design, clinical monitoring, and finishing. 

Designed for licensed dentists who want to approach clear aligner cases responsibly, clinically, and within their professional scope of practice. 

Course Overview

Clear aligner therapy continues to grow in patient demand — but predictable outcomes require more than software approval or appliance delivery. Successful treatment depends on accurate diagnosis, appropriate case selection, biomechanical understanding, careful prescription writing, patient communication, and structured clinical monitoring. 

This two-day continuing education course provides a practical, evidence-informed introduction to clear aligner orthodontics for general dentists. Participants will review orthodontic diagnosis, treatment-planning principles, aligner biomechanics, attachment protocols, IPR considerations, digital workflows, case submission processes, and clinical management strategies. 

The course is led by Dr. Mostafa Altalibi, DMD, D.Ortho, FRCD(C), a certified orthodontist, international lecturer, and educator in clear aligner therapy. 

This course is educational in nature and is intended to support clinical understanding, decision-making, and professional development. Participation does not certify, authorize, or guarantee clinical competency in orthodontics or clear aligner treatment. Dentists remain responsible for practicing within their legal scope, training, competence, and applicable regulatory requirements.

Course Highlights

Diagnose and Select Cases More Confidently 

  • Learn how to assess orthodontic records, identify suitable clear aligner cases, recognize case complexity, and understand when referral or specialist involvement may be appropriate. 

Understand Aligner Biomechanics 

  • Review the biological and mechanical principles behind clear aligner movement, including staging, force systems, attachments, anchorage, tracking, and limitations. 

Build Better Treatment Plans 

  • Develop a structured approach to treatment planning, including clinical objectives, risk assessment, sequencing, patient expectations, and communication. 

Write Clearer Aligner Prescriptions 

  • Learn how to translate clinical goals into prescription instructions that support more predictable planning and case execution. 

Apply Clinical Protocols Hands-On 

  • Participate in practical exercises involving attachments, IPR demonstration, digital workflow, case submission, and treatment-planning review. 

Manage and Finish Cases Responsibly 

  • Understand monitoring appointments, refinements, troubleshooting, finishing protocols, retention planning, and post-treatment considerations. 

 

Key Competencies​

Orthodontic Diagnosis 

Evaluate malocclusion, crowding, spacing, bite relationships, midlines, arch form, and case complexity 

Case Selection 

Identify appropriate cases for general practice and recognize when referral or specialist collaboration is warranted 

Treatment Planning 

Create structured objectives based on diagnosis, risk factors, patient expectations, and clinical limitations

Aligner Biomechanics

Understand movement predictability, attachment design, staging, anchorage, IPR planning, and tracking issues

Digital Workflow

Scanning, records collection, case submission, prescription communication, and treatment plan evaluation

Clinical Monitoring

Patient visits, progress evaluation, compliance assessment, troubleshooting, refinements, and finishing

Risk Management

Consent, alternatives, risks, timelines, compliance, retention, and referral considerations

Course Objectives ​

By the end of this course, learners will be able to:

  • Identify appropriate and inappropriate clear aligner cases based on clinical findings, case complexity, and provider competence. 
  • Describe key diagnostic considerations in orthodontic treatment planning, including occlusion, crowding, spacing, bite relationships, midlines, and periodontal considerations. 
  • Explain basic clear aligner biomechanics, including staging, attachments, anchorage, IPR, tracking, and movement predictability. 
  • Develop structured treatment objectives for clear aligner cases. 
  • Write clearer aligner prescription instructions that communicate clinical priorities and desired movements. 
  • Review digital treatment plans with a clinical decision-making framework rather than relying solely on software-generated outcomes. 
  • Demonstrate understanding of attachment placement protocols and IPR considerations. 
  • Describe how to monitor aligner treatment, identify common problems, and manage refinements. 
  • Discuss finishing, retention, patient compliance, and post-treatment stability considerations. 
  • Recognize when a case should be referred to, or co-managed with, an orthodontic specialist.
